The length of a side of an equilateral triangle is 40cm. what is the length of the altitude of the triangle?
podryga [215]

Answer:

20√3 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

Altitude of an equilateral triangle splits it into 2 equal right triangles, it bisects the base and the angle opposite to the base.

<u>Let the altitude be x. Then as per Pythagorean theorem:</u>

  • x² = 40² - (40/2)²
  • x²= 1600 -400
  • x²= 1200
  • x= √1200
  • x= 20√3 cm
